Texas's extreme heat can cause metal fatigue and expansion in torsion springs. High humidity can also contribute to corrosion over time. Proper spring selection and regular maintenance are key to ensuring durability in this climate.

Attempting DIY repair of torsion springs is extremely dangerous. These components store immense tension and can cause severe injury if not handled with professional expertise and equipment. Always opt for professional service.
A typical garage door torsion spring lasts between 10,000 and 20,000 cycles. Factors like frequency of use, door weight, and environmental conditions, such as those in Texas, can influence this lifespan.

Torsion springs are mounted horizontally above the garage door on a torsion bar and operate by twisting to lift the door. Extension springs, in contrast, run parallel to the door tracks and lift the door by stretching.
